PRIME is the first student association of Public Relations and Communication in Romania. Through its four departments and two major external events, students passionate about the communication field have the opportunity to build a direct connection with industry specialists, apply what they learn in university, and deepen their academic knowledge through practical activities. 🔎 Beyond the professional benefits, PRIME also teaches you how to create meaningful connections, how to make your voice heard, and, just as importantly, how to collect experiences worth sharing with your friends for years to come. 🫶

A real agency in disguise
Even if it sometimes feels like you’re in a game like The Sims or The Impostor, the experience in PRIME closely mirrors real agency life. ✨ How? Even though members work within different departments, collaboration is at the core of everything they do. Projects are developed through constant communication between teams, just as tasks and campaigns are coordinated in a real agency. This cross-functional way of working ensures that every idea benefits from multiple perspectives before becoming a final product. 🎈 In addition, members take part in training, workshops, and learning sessions designed to develop both their professional and personal skills. The experience also includes pitch simulations, where participants present their ideas and receive feedback, closely mirroring the process of pitching to a real client. This hands-on approach prepares students for the realities of the communication industry in a practical and structured way. 🪩
